We have the following function:
f (x) = x ^ 2
We have the following transformation:
Expansions and horizontal compressions
The graph of y = f (bx):
If 0 <b <1, the graph of y = f (x) expands horizontally by the factor of 1 / b.
Applying the transformation:
y = (0.2x) ^ 2
The factor is:
1 / b = 1 / 0.2 = 5
Answer:
b. expanded horizontally by a factor of 5
